An electrical junction box is a protective housing designed to enclose and shield electrical wire connections or splices. For outdoor installations, the box must defend these sensitive splices against moisture, dust, temperature fluctuations, and physical impacts.     To figure out the number of ports, you need to: For example, count your current devices (computers, cameras, printers), add 20% to 30% depending on your environment, to account for future expansion, and then select the nearest standard patch panel size, rounding up as needed. Patch panel port density indicates the number of ports available within a particular amount of rack space. Rack height is measured in rack units (U). 75.
